Grant Wallace brings a wealth of coaching knowledge into his 12th full year heading up Kenyon's golf team. Originally hired, during the 2011-12 academic year, to oversee the College's intramural and club sports programs, he gradually took over the golf program in the spring of 2013 and has steadily improved it during his time here. Since then, he has compiled a 900-516 coaching record.

Kenyon had perhaps the best season of its 96-year history in 2024, ultimately finishing in a tie for eighth place at the NCAA Division III Men's Golf Championship. The Owls brought home their second NCAC title in three years to earn a berth in the tournament, as five players collected All-NCAC honors, two earned All-Region selections and one made the All-America team. Wallace was named the NCAC's Coach of the Year for the fourth time along with earning the GCAA Region V Coach of the Year honor. Additionally, the Owls were named the 2023-24 GCAA Academic National Champions after their success on the course and in the classroom.

In 2023, the Owls navigated a strong schedule and the departure of seven seniors. Kenyon racked up a trio of top-five finishes during the regular season before finishing in bronze medal position in the NCAC Championship. Three players earned All-NCAC recognition for their tournament finishes, while a quartet of Owls were named GCAA All-America Scholars. 

Clear signs of improvement were the results cranked out by the 2022 team, which won the NCAC Championship for the first time in program history and made the program’s first appearance in the NCAA Division III Championship since the 1989 season. Wallace was voted 2022 NCAC Coach of the Year, while Nick Lust won the Dick Gordin Award, for being medalist at the NCAC Championship, and Armand Ouellette was crowned both NCAC Player of the Year and NCAC Newcomer of the Year. 

Additionally, the 2022 team, which finished 15th at the NCAA Division III Championship, had two players, Ouellette and Eric Lifson, named to the PING All-Region team, while Ouellette went on to achieve PING All-America status. Wallace himself was a finalist for the 2022 Dave Williams Award, which honors the national coach of the year in NCAA Division III men's golf.   

In 2017-18, Wallace mentored PING All-America selection and NCAC Player of the Year Ryan Muthiora, along with three other all-conference selections in Lawrence Courtney, Sadiq Jiwa and Lifson. By season's end, Muthiora and Courtney had received individual invites for the NCAA Division III Championship. Those two were also semifinalists for the NCAA Division III Jack Nicklaus Player of the Year award. Wallace was named the 2018 GCAA Great Lakes Region Coach of the Year and NCAC Coach of the Year. 

During the 2014-15 season, Wallace helped steer the golf program through another great season. The team had a pair of first-place finishes and six other top-three finishes. At the end of the year, Alex Blickle and Jake Fait became Kenyon's first-ever PING All-Great Lakes Region selections. In light of his team's accomplishments, Wallace was named the NCAC Coach of the Year.
 
Wallace is a Titleist Performance Institute (TPI) Level 2 Golf with additional certification in TPI Level 2 fitness. In addition, he is an Aim Point Express certified golf coach and is an active user of Trackman, applying its data to improving his golfers.

Wallace earned a master’s of education degree at Bowling Green State University. While at BGSU, he worked closely with varsity teams and also advised several club sports teams, including baseball. In addition to his master’s from BGSU, Wallace also holds a bachelor's degree in business administration from Sacramento State University.
